The 6-Step Roadmap Journey Concept is a free diagram for presentations in PowerPoint and Google Slides and provides an effective way to plan out a personal journey, project, or process. It represents a horizontal broken thin line forming a sequence of 6 arrows as a concept of a timeline or a roadmap with 6 milestones, steps, stages, parts, or phases.

This structure begins with understanding the current situation, clearly defining what success looks like, developing a strategy blueprint, building out the tactics to implement the actions required to reach the end goal, setting up processes and KPIs in order to identify progress along the way and make adjustments if needed, and finally evaluating and continuously improving. With this approach, it's easier to stay on track with the objectives you want to achieve so that you can reach your destination even faster.
